Braids work best in hair that has some texture. So if you’ve just washed your hair don’t blow dry it too well, or use a dry shampoo to add some texture. This hairstyle is perfect for second day hair.
Here’s how to get the look:
- Brush your hair to remove all knots.
- Take a section at the top left and divide into three parts.
- Dutch braid (also called inside out braid) – bring the left under the middle, then the right under the middle, and keep repeating.
- Add in sections of hair from each side as you braid.
- Angle your braid diagonally across your head.
- Keep braiding to the end and secure with a hair band.
- Loosen the braid by pulling gently to make it look bigger.
- Twist the end of the braid around to create a flat bun and pin in place.
If your hair is very long, you can finish this hairstyle in a side ponytail or braided bun.
